Overview

What if the origin of time wasn't a bang... but a pulse? Before stars had names or clocks had hands, there was rhythm. A trinary resonance. A memory ripple. A mirror awakening. The Bloom Sequence: Origins of the Trinary Pulse is more than a companion to Lucy the Awakened Lucidian-it is the source text that echoes through her dreams, her pendants, and the mirrors that respond to thought. Part mythos, part metaphysical manual, and part memory-coded artifact, this poetic transmission explores the hidden origin of the Pulse-a tri-frequency harmonic that reverberates across dimensions, timelines, and identity itself. Here, memory is not stored in stone or scripture, but in frequency, light, and living geometry. It is said that the Pulse preceded language, birthed the Lucidian lattice, and still flickers beneath all awakenings. Whether you've already entered Lucy's story or this is your first time encountering the Bloom Garden, this short codex serves as both an entry point and a mirror... a gateway into the architecture of mirrored realities, memory fractals, and the forgotten song beneath creation. You do not read this book. You remember it. - The Bloom Sequence: Origins of the Trinary Pulse is a standalone companion to The Lucidian Library-a growing collection of works exploring dream logic, trinary consciousness, and symbolic memory through the mythos of the Lucidian realms.
